Comet ISON (C/2012 S1), as observed on 30th April 2013 by the Hubble Space Telescope (HST). This comet was discovered on 21 September 2012 by the International Scientific Optical Network (ISON). Here, it 585 million kilometres from the Sun and 650 million kilometres from Earth. It will pass close to the Sun in November 2013, increasing greatly in brightness.
